We’d also like to share a few important expectations to ensure a fun and positive experience for all:
Respect for Volunteers: Coaches, referees, and organizers are giving their time for our kids—let’s support them with patience and positivity.
Community Spirit: Our focus is on player development, enjoyment of the game, and building lasting friendships.
Game Day Behavior: Please always encourage good sportsmanship. Cheer for effort and teamwork, respect referees and opponents, and remember that our players are still learning. Speaking of referees – US Soccer has come out with a hard line on referee abuse especially our young youth officials. Please see the Referee Abuse Policy that sets expectations and legal ramifications for referee abuses. Those responsible for misconduct at any ACYSC event or game will be subject to penalties and pay all fees and fines associated.
